Fascination About what is md5's application
Fascination About what is md5's application
Blog Article
All we must do is transfer Each and every bit 7 spaces towards the left. We will get it done using an intermediate phase to really make it simpler to see what is happening:
The MD5 algorithm continues to be well-liked previously to crypt passwords in databases. The objective was to avoid keeping them in clear textual content. In this manner they weren't exposed in case of security breach or hack. Since then, utilizing the MD5 algorithm for This is certainly no more advisable.
Should you be even now puzzled by how these calculations function, Maybe it’s a good idea to look into the modular arithmetic url posted earlier mentioned. Another option is to transform the hexadecimal numbers into decimal quantities.
We started off this journey again in June 2016, and we prepare to continue it for many far more several years to come back. I hope that you will join us During this dialogue in the past, existing and future of EdTech and lend your own personal insight to the issues that are talked over.
The ultimate values from Procedure 3 turn into the initialization vectors for operation four, and the final values from operation four become the initialization vectors for Procedure 5.
Comprehending MD5’s limits and weaknesses is important for ensuring that cryptographic tactics evolve to satisfy modern day security worries.
Collision Vulnerabilities: In 2004, researchers demonstrated that MD5 is prone to collision assaults, exactly where two diverse inputs can create the identical hash. This is especially perilous because it permits an attacker to substitute a destructive file or information for a reputable one particular though maintaining exactly the same hash worth, bypassing integrity checks. Preimage and 2nd Preimage Assaults: When preimage assaults (getting an enter that hashes to a specific hash) and second preimage attacks (discovering a special input that generates precisely the same hash for a specified enter) remain computationally complicated for MD5, the vulnerabilities in collision resistance make MD5 fewer protected for contemporary Cryptographic Procedures applications.
Digital Forensics: MD5 hash values were commonly Employed in digital forensics to tai xiu online verify the integrity of electronic evidence. Investigators could build hash values of documents and compare them with regarded values to make certain evidence remained unaltered in the course of the investigation.
In this post, we examine the underlying procedures with the MD5 algorithm and how the math powering the MD5 hash perform operates.
Business Adoption: SHA-256 and SHA-three have obtained prevalent adoption and therefore are regarded as secure by field benchmarks and regulatory bodies. They are really Utilized in SSL/TLS certificates, digital signatures, and numerous security protocols.
Within this blog, we’ll dive into why MD5 is now not the hero it after was, the dangers it poses, and what’s taken its spot. We’ll also chat about sensible tips for preserving your info safe and the way to transfer clear of MD5 in more mature methods.
MD5 was greatly made use of in the past for various cryptographic and data integrity purposes. Its speed and performance built it a popular option for hashing passwords, validating details integrity, and building electronic signatures.
An assault exactly where an attacker takes advantage of the hash worth of a recognised concept to compute the hash of an extended message, exploiting hash purpose vulnerabilities.
This hash price acts to be a digital fingerprint of the data. By evaluating the hash value of the gained details with the initial hash value, you can verify if the info is altered or corrupted all through transmission or storage.